@@ -0,0 +1,99 @@ | ||
use codee::{CodecError, Decoder, Encoder}; | ||
use leptos::prelude::{signal, Effect, Get, GetUntracked, LocalStorage, ReadSignal, Set, Signal, UpdateUntracked, WriteSignal}; | ||
use leptos_use::core::MaybeRwSignal; | ||
use leptos_use::storage::{ | ||
use_storage_with_options, StorageType, UseStorageError, UseStorageOptions, | ||
}; | ||
use std::fmt::Debug; | ||
|
||
pub(crate) struct UseStorageReturn<T, Remover> | ||
where | ||
T: Send + Sync + 'static, | ||
Remover: Fn() + Clone + Send + Sync, | ||
{ | ||
pub(crate) read: Signal<T>, | ||
pub(crate) write: WriteSignal<T>, | ||
pub(crate) remove: Remover, | ||
|
||
#[expect(unused)] | ||
decode_err: (ReadSignal<bool>, WriteSignal<bool>), | ||
#[expect(unused)] | ||
effect: Effect<LocalStorage>, | ||
} | ||
|
||
pub(crate) fn use_storage_with_options_and_error_handler<T, C>( | ||
storage_type: StorageType, | ||
key: impl Into<Signal<String>> + 'static, | ||
// Read once on creation. Reused through cloning when a decode error must be resolved by using the initial value again. | ||
initial_value: impl Into<MaybeRwSignal<T>>, | ||
) -> UseStorageReturn<T, impl Fn() + Clone + Send + Sync> | ||
where | ||
T: Default + Debug + Clone + PartialEq + Send + Sync, | ||
C: Encoder<T, Encoded = String> + Decoder<T, Encoded = str>, | ||
<C as Encoder<T>>::Error: Debug, | ||
<C as Decoder<T>>::Error: Debug, | ||
{ | ||
let (decode_err, set_decode_err) = signal(false); | ||
|
||
let key = key.into(); | ||
|
||
let initial_value_signal = initial_value.into(); | ||
let initial_value = match &initial_value_signal { | ||
MaybeRwSignal::Static(s) => s.clone(), | ||
MaybeRwSignal::DynamicRw(r, _) => r.get_untracked(), | ||
MaybeRwSignal::DynamicRead(r) => r.get_untracked(), | ||
}; | ||
let options = UseStorageOptions::default() | ||
.initial_value(initial_value_signal) | ||
.listen_to_storage_changes(true) | ||
.delay_during_hydration(false) | ||
.on_error(move |err| { | ||
let log_as_error = match &err { | ||
UseStorageError::StorageNotAvailable(_) => true, | ||
UseStorageError::StorageReturnedNone => true, | ||
UseStorageError::GetItemFailed(_) => true, | ||
UseStorageError::SetItemFailed(_) => true, | ||
UseStorageError::RemoveItemFailed(_) => true, | ||
UseStorageError::NotifyItemChangedFailed(_) => true, | ||
UseStorageError::ItemCodecError(codec_err) => match codec_err { | ||
CodecError::Encode(_) => true, | ||
CodecError::Decode(_decode_err) => { | ||
// Only schedule deletion (and log) once! | ||
// We saw that these decode errors may come in multiple times in quick | ||
// succession, without our effect being able to handle it in between. | ||
if !decode_err.get_untracked() { | ||
// Note: A "decode" error will always come up if we break the | ||
// type, e.g. by adding a new field that wasn't previously | ||
// persisted. | ||
tracing::debug!(?err, "Data format of '{}' changed. Scheduling removal of previously persisted value.", key.get()); | ||
set_decode_err.set(true); | ||
} | ||
false | ||
} | ||
}, | ||
}; | ||
if log_as_error { | ||
tracing::error!(?err, "Error reading '{}' from storage.", key.get()); | ||
} | ||
}); | ||
|
||
let (read, write, remove) = use_storage_with_options::<T, C>(storage_type, key, options); | ||
|
||
let remove_clone = remove.clone(); | ||
let effect = Effect::new(move |_| { | ||
if decode_err.get() { | ||
tracing::trace!("Removing previously persisted value of '{}' due to a decode error. Using initial value: {initial_value:?}", key.get()); | ||
remove_clone(); | ||
write.set(initial_value.clone()); | ||
set_decode_err.update_untracked(|it| *it = false); | ||
} | ||
}); | ||
|
||
UseStorageReturn { | ||
read, | ||
write, | ||
remove, | ||
decode_err: (decode_err, set_decode_err), | ||
effect, | ||
} | ||
} |
